sandritsch91/yii2-froala-editor

从 froala/yii2-froala-editor 扩展的 Yii2 Froala Editor 小部件

安装: 164

依赖: 0

建议者: 1

安全性: 0

星星: 0

关注者: 1

分支: 0

语言:JavaScript

类型:yii2-extension

1.1.1 2024-08-08 09:14 UTC

This package is auto-updated.

Last update: 2024-09-08 09:23:32 UTC


README

froala/yii2-froala-editor 的扩展

安装

安装此扩展的首选方式是通过 composer

运行以下命令之一:

php composer.phar require --prefer-dist sandritsch91/yii2-froala-editor

或者在 composer.json 的 require 部分

"sandritsch91/yii2-froala-editor": "*"

添加

默认配置

此小部件扩展了原始的 FroalaEditor 小部件。必须这样做才能以 Yii2 的方式配置 FroalaEditor。我还添加了一些默认选项,您可以在应用程序配置或小部件配置中覆盖它们。

产品密钥

您可以在应用程序的(本地)配置中设置产品密钥

'container' => [
    'definitions' => [
        'sandritsch91\yii2\froala\FroalaEditor' => [
            'defaultClientOptions' => [
                'key' => 'YOUR_PRODUCT_KEY',
            ]
        ]
    ]
]

插件

原始 FroalaEditor 以动态方式添加插件,这使得无法以 Yii2 的方式配置它们。它们默认全部加载,但您可以在小部件配置中禁用它们。

<?= FroalaEditor::widget([
    'clientPlugins' => [
        ...
    ],
    'excludedPlugins' => [
        ...
    ],
]); ?>